Transaction e5cccaa2ba5a3128cf61d9c9f13630bbec7984d0e7bbd8efe7dc1b9ca2bdca7f
1 Input
1 Output
-
e5cccaa2ba5a3128cf61d9c9f13630bbec7984d0e7bbd8efe7dc1b9ca2bdca7f:0
- value
- 89303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bc8f72366cffd42babd7ddd63394a3232da3ab2 OP_EQUAL
- address
- 3ES8bXZwogvARetPWoNebXvD6sZ4K9M83m